Technical field
The utility model relates to LED display field, is specifically related to the LED display of excellent heat radiation performance, and it is for substituting existing larger LED ad display screen.
Background technology
LED has replaced a lot of traditional lighting light fixtures gradually with its power savings advantages; Existing LED advertisement electronic curtain is universal coming, because the service time of advertisement electrical screen is long, adopts LED can more embody energy saving as light source; For larger LED advertisement screen, its bandwagon effect is very good, energy-saving effect is more obvious simultaneously, but what be accompanied by is that the heat of generation of LED illuminating module is more and more, and be difficult for being discharged from, the light efficiency variation that causes LED illuminating module affects serviceable life of LED illuminating module simultaneously; Traditional radiator structure has active heat removal and passive heat radiation, commonly fan cooling and heat radiator heat radiation, and its radiating effect is all not ideal for large-size screen monitors or super large screen LED display.

A kind of LED display with cooling mechanism described in the utility model, it has the following advantages:
The utility model is with the LED display of cooling mechanism, and it adopts the mode of ventilation and heat and refrigeration radiating to improve the heat-sinking capability of whole display screen, is highly suitable for the heat radiation of the LED display of large-size screen monitors or super large screen; Concrete, ventilation and heat adopts the structure of air vent, and housing has air vent, wiring board has air vent, and the flat board that simultaneously freezes also has air vent, and this mode has certain natural heat dissipation ability, also there is the advantage of Homogeneouslly-radiating simultaneously, be unlikely to produce the situation of screen somewhere temperature inequality; More specifically, the air-conditioning refrigeration system that refrigeration radiating adopts, the cooling power of last evaporator is all dispersed to heat exchange flat board uniformly, makes so whole heat radiation process adopt cold wind evenly to trim a LED display, and heat radiation homogeneity and cooling-down effect are very good.
